COSCO Delivers Bulker

October 25, 2014

 

The Board of Directors of COSCO Corporation (Singapore) Limited announced that COSCO (Dalian) Shipyard Co., Ltd a subsidiary of the Company's 51% owned COSCO Shipyard Group Co., Ltd, has delivered a 80,000 DWT bulk carrier, "CIC EPOS", to its European Buyer.
 

The delivery documents were signed by and between COSCO Dalian and the buyer recently.
